## Escalation — Nightly Search Reindex (Lumenfind)

The Lumenfind reindex job runs at 02:00 and normally completes in 90 minutes. If it has not finished by 04:30, check the indexer logs for shard allocation errors and verify the source snapshot completed. One retry is acceptable; do not run two reindexes concurrently. If the retry fails, serve from the previous index and escalate to the search platform team at the address below.

billing contact of kagaf-bahif = fraox_ralvan_tamwyn@zemvarcloud.local

Subject: DR drill — InvoiceForge renderer, Thursday

Welcome aboard. Thursday's drill simulates total loss of the InvoiceForge PDF rendering cluster in the Dunmere region. Your role: restore the renderer from the cold snapshot, verify font embedding, and confirm a test invoice renders identically to the golden copy. You'll need access to the sealed restore account, which stays dormant outside drills. Do not reset it; doing so invalidates the escrow. The account's recovery passphrase is recorded below.

vault phrase of kajop-kaweg = sorix-istys-noviel

Internal Memo — Heads of Department

Hi all — quick heads-up on next year's headcount plan for Fennick & Sons. The short version: we're growing, but carefully. Overall headcount rises by about 9%, weighted toward the Oakhurst distribution site and the product team. Backfills still need sign-off from Dana Wrexall, and contractor conversions get priority over new openings. Draft numbers land with you next week; please sanity-check before we lock them. The strategic reasoning sits in the confidential note just below.

management briefing: The pricing group signed off on a budget of $378.8 million for Project Kasael.

Fan-out backpressure for the Quillet notifier: when the queue depth crosses the soft limit, the dispatcher sheds low-priority pushes and batches the rest at 500ms intervals. Reviewer should confirm the shed counter is exported and that retries respect the jitter window. Once merged, the release artifact gets re-signed by the pipeline, which expects the deploy key shown below.

deploy key for bawep-yawif: bky6_GQhaSt